Today is a very big day for a very tiny boy. Baby Joseph is being picked up from the hospital and heading to his new home! He is going to El Roi baby home which is run through Heart For Africa ministries. You can find out more about Heart For Africa by clicking here. I have been chatting with the co-founder of Heart For Africa, Janine Maxwell, over the past couple of days. Our chats have been online, as she is currently out of the country, but we have committed to meeting face to face once she is back in Swaziland next month. I have also had her re-assure me that my family and I can go visit Joseph at El Roi once he is settled in. El Roi is one of the Hebrew names for God and it means 'the God who continually sees me'. Isn't that a perfect description of the way the Lord God has been watching over and caring for this little boy during his short time on this earth? I find such peace and comfort in this.
 
Sadly, Janine told me that since opening the doors of El Roi in March of 2012 they have taken in 15 abandoned babies, one third of which were found in pit/latrine toilets just like Joseph. Heartbreaking...
